Epiphany's Kitchen in Ghent seems like the ideal place for a romantic first date: it offers plenty of time for conversation and a sense of opulence.
This statement is made with some sarcasm, as our experience at Epiphany's Kitchen was a mixture of highs and lows.
The starters were a true testament to original and delicious dishes, presenting an array of flavours that tantalised the taste buds. However, the main course, while decent, didn't quite reach the extraordinary heights set by the starters. Given the hefty price tag, overall value for money seemed lacking, especially when compared to other similarly targeted restaurants we've been to which offer more satisfying flavours at a lower cost.
Taste is subjective, so I wouldn't write a bad review just because we didn't like the food as much, even if it was expensive, but the biggest disappointment was the length of the meal. Our dinner lasted almost three hours, forcing us to stay even after the restaurant officially closed. The courteous staff couldn't be faulted for providing attentive service throughout, despite the long wait between courses, which was largely due to the slow pace of the kitchen.
We still really like the concept of the restaurant, which offers intriguing vegan dishes with the option of incorporating non-vegan elements such as cheese or meat, otherwise we would not have chosen to go there. The welcoming atmosphere added to the overall appeal. Sadly, however, the prices and long waiting times make me reluctant to visit Epiphany's Kitchen again. The restaurant is stunning, it's like stepping into a fairytale. Everywhere you look has a point of interest, even the ceiling is fun to look at. I liked the candle holders the most.
The menu is trendy. We had three starters that were meant to be shared: puff pastries filled with chili sin carne, purple moscovite potatoes with herring roe, and lightly blanched veggies with a cheesy dipping sauce. The potato dish was especially delicate. We cleaned out the cheese bowl.
Then we had spicy peanut "pasta". We picked the sweet potato pasta replacement. It was so good I forgot to take a picture :)
Mascarpone and chocolate cake desserts were our favourite. The sabayon was a little too sour for my tastes, but that was a case of personal preference.
Service was slow in places, due to unforeseen popularity and an injury in the kitchen. We didn't mind, we had a great time and didn't want to leave.
